100G Single Lambda is the new technology developed for QSFP28 100G optics by the MSA group, designed to cut down the high cost operation for operators using the existing 100G SR4, LR4, CWDM4 and PSM4. 100G Single Lambda uses PAM4 optical modulation to couple 4*25G NRZ eletrical signal into 1*100G PAM4 Single lambda laser with the gearbox DSP chip. The single lambda PAM4 modulation greatly simplifies the complexity of mux/demux and integrate four 25G signals into a 100G link and cut down the costly optical components.
The 100G Lambda optics uses single wavelength of 1310nm and PAM4 50GBaud modulation, so enables the compatiblility with same QSFP-DD 400G optics. Such as, QSFP-DD PLR4 Optics uses 4 parallel link of 1310NM 100G PAM4 50GBaud optical signal, can link to four 100G-LR Single lambda QSFP28 100G Optics with Breakout cables and provide the smooth transition from 100G into 400G.
The Arista compatible QSFP28 100G LR1 Transceivers can be plugged into any Arista 100G QSFP port. The electrical connector interface is 4 * 25G NRZ, the same as all existing legacy QSFP28 100G modules. But, not like 100G LR4 mux/demux 4 * 25G NRZ optical signal into one fiber, the QSFP28 100G LR1 Transceivers uses a gearbox chip to convert the 4 * 25G NRZ electrical signals into a 1 * 100G PAM4 optical signal and couples into the single wavelength laser (or "lambda") for transmission. Due to different optical modulation, QSFP28 100G LR1 modules will not interoperate with legacy 100G LR4 module.
The Top-Trans QSFP28 100G PAM4 LR1 optics uses single lambda signal of 50GBaud on 1310nm center wavelength and supports the link lengths of up to 10km via G.652 single mode fiber. The Top-Trans QSFP28 100G PAM4 LR1 optics uses PAM4 optical modulation and FEC and is fully compliant with MSA QSFP28 100GBASE-LR Single Lambda. The QSFP28 100G PAM4 LR1 optics can extend the fiber link to interconnect nearby infrastructure within 10km and be ideal for the interconnect of spine to core or spine/spine or DCI etc for campus & data center network.

Can your optics interoper with QSFP28 LR4?
No, their optical modulation are different, when LR4 uses 4 * 25G NRZ but this LR1 uses 1 * 100G PAM4
